Teaspoon - 'PLENTY' Picture-back - London circa 1775 by Philip Roker - 10.9cm long; 9.5g - MF/1545
A rare picture back silver teaspoon that was presumably produced to celebrate a year of good harvest. The picture on the spoon depicts a healthily sized wheat sheath surmounted by the word "PLENTY". This Georgian Old English pattern spoon is appropriately bottom-marked for pre-1781 teaspoons with lion passant and a clear "PR" makers mark. It remains in excellent condition with a crisp picture and good bowl.
